Bonus Strategy and Mathematical Calculations
Pointsbet offers various bonuses, such as welcome offers and free bets. Understanding the math behind these can help you optimize returns:
- Example Calculation: Suppose you receive a $100 bonus with a 5x wagering requirement on sports bets at average odds of 2.0. The total amount to wager is $100 * 5 = $500. If you bet on outcomes with a 50% probability, expected value can be calculated: Expected profit = (Bonus amount) – (Wagering * House edge). Assuming a 5% house edge, expected loss = $500 * 0.05 = $25, so net gain = $100 – $25 = $75, but this varies with bet success.
- Strategy: Use bonuses on low-risk bets to meet requirements efficiently, and always read terms for game restrictions.
